The Los Angeles Lakers are predicted to cut ties with Dalton Knecht in the form of a trade after he asked to be moved by the deadline.

The Los Angeles Lakers already tried to trade former first-round pick Dalton Knecht last year, and while that resulted in a tumultuous relationship going forward between the two sides, the player finally looks like he’ll be on the move.

After the report from NBA insider Marc Stein that the Lakers have discussed the idea of moving Knecht, Anthony Irwin responded with the news that the second-year guard approached the front office and asked for a trade directly. 

I‘m told Dalton Knecht approached the Lakers front office recently and has asked to be traded,Irwin wrote in a post on X.It’s expected they’ll grant his wish.”

Broderick Turner and Thuc Nhi Nguyen of the LA Times also confirmed the news that Knecht could be moved sometime before the deadline. While it’s unclear where he’ll go next, the Lakers have their eyes on a few trade targets, a few of which they could use the shooter as a piece to get back some of them in return.


Lakers Expect To Trade Dalton Knecht

As mentioned, there have now been multiple reports on the Lakers and Knecht both feeling as though a new change of scenery would be best. They previously tried to trade him last year for Mark Williams, then on the Charlotte Hornets, but a failed physical stopped that deal in its tracks. 

Since then, Knecht’s numbers have dropped, and while he’s still gotten in a ton of games for Los Angeles this season, he’s spent more time in the G-League and hasn’t maintained a consistent roster spot in head coach JJ Redick’s rotation. 

“He was a first-round pick in 2024, but is only seeing 12.5 minutes per night in 36 games this season and hasn’t played at all outside of garbage time over the past two weeks,Arthur Hill of Hoopsrumors.com wrote on Knecht. 

While only averaging 4.8 points, 1.6 rebounds, and 0.4 assists on 43.7/31.9/68.8 shooting splits, Turner and Nguyen added that the team’s 2032 second-round pick could be added in a trade with Knecht to bring back someone who could help the current iteration of the team. 

For now, both Knecht finding a new home and the Lakers moving on from what has been a failed experiment looks like the best idea for both sides. 


Lakers Trade Rumors, Giannis Hopes

While Los Angeles has been linked to a ton of other names over this current trade cycle, one now stands out above the rest: Giannis Antetokounmpo of the Milwaukee Bucks

Shams Charania recently reported the superstar is ready to part ways with his current team before the trade deadline, and while the Lakers were expected to more seriously consider a deal for him over the summer, like so many other teams in the league, those plans have now changed.

According to the insider, the Bucks are looking for either a blue-chip young talent or a surplus of draft picks. The Lakers don’t have the picks, so a deal for Antetokounmpo would likely have to be highlighted by Austin Reaves and as many other assets as they can possibly move

Writing for Bleacher Report, Any Bailey outlined a deal that doesn’t include Reaves, but it would be impossible to make before the deadline, as it included their draft picks that can’t be moved until this summer. 

Any deal before February 5th would have to include Reaves, and if the Lakers are serious about pairing Antetokounmpo with Luka Doncic, they’ll face that tough decision. If not, waiting until the summer might be risky, as teams around the league are lining up to offer as much as they can for the two-time regular-season MVP.
